The European Convention for the Protection of Vertebrate Animals Used for Experimental and Other Scientific Purposes is an international treaty aimed at safeguarding the welfare of vertebrate animals involved in scientific experiments. It establishes a framework for the ethical treatment and use of animals in research within the member states.
This convention was adopted in 1986 and has been ratified by numerous European countries. Its primary objective is to promote the replacement, reduction, and refinement of the use of animals in experiments (commonly known as the "3Rs" principle). The convention sets standards for the housing, care, and use of animals, ensuring that their suffering is minimized and that experiments are conducted only when justified by scientific purposes.
The convention also emphasizes the importance of providing education and training for researchers, regulators, and animal care staff to ensure compliance with ethical and welfare standards. It serves as a significant step towards harmonizing animal research practices across Europe and promoting responsible and humane use of animals in scientific endeavors.

which of the following occurs when an enzyme binds a non-competitive inhibitor? group of answer choices the kd will increase but vmax will not change the vmax will decrease but kd will not change kd will increase and vmax will decrease there is not enough information
When an enzyme binds a non-competitive inhibitor, the vmax will decrease but the kd will not change.
An enzyme is a protein that acts as a biological catalyst by increasing the rate of chemical reactions in living organisms. The substrate is the molecule that an enzyme catalyzes, while the active site is the region of the enzyme where the substrate binds.
An enzyme inhibitor is a chemical or molecule that inhibits the action of an enzyme. Non-competitive inhibitors can bind to the enzyme either at the active site or at an allosteric site. The activity of the enzyme is decreased by non-competitive inhibitors that bind to allosteric sites.
As a result, the Vmax (maximum velocity of the reaction) decreases, but the Kd (dissociation constant) does not change. This implies that the affinity of the enzyme for the substrate does not alter.
The Michaelis-Menten equation can be used to study the effect of enzyme inhibitors on enzyme-catalyzed reactions.
Therefore, when an enzyme binds a non-competitive inhibitor, the Vmax will decrease, but the Kd will not change.

What is the importance of the amniotic egg?
Answer:
The amniotic egg was an evolutionary invention that allowed the first reptiles to colonize dry land more than 300 million years ago. Fishes and amphibians must lay their eggs in water and therefore cannot live far from water. But thanks to the amniotic egg, reptiles can lay their eggs nearly anywhere on dry land.

bronchial circulation differs from the pulmonary circulation by providing blood for the:
Bronchial circulation differs from pulmonary circulation in that it provides blood supply to the structures of the lungs themselves, including the bronchi, bronchioles, and connective tissues.
This circulation is responsible for delivering oxygenated blood to the lung tissues and removing deoxygenated blood. In contrast, pulmonary circulation refers to blood flow between the heart and the lungs, specifically involving the exchange of oxygen and carbon dioxide in the alveoli. It supplies deoxygenated blood from the right side of the heart to the lungs for oxygenation and returns oxygenated blood to the left side of the heart for distribution to the rest of the body.

the first evidence for nucleosome formation came from digesting chromosomal dna with a non-specific nuclease. gel electrophoresis of the dna after the reaction revealed:
The first evidence for nucleosome formation came from digesting chromosomal DNA with a non-specific nuclease. Gel electrophoresis of the DNA after the reaction revealed a ladder-like pattern of DNA fragments, indicating the presence of repeating units, which were later identified as nucleosomes.
Gel electrophoresis is a laboratory technique for separating DNA, RNA, or protein mixtures based on molecular size. An electrical field pushes the molecules to be separated through a gel with microscopic holes in gel electrophoresis. The molecules move through the pores in the gel at a rate that is proportional to their length. This indicates that a little DNA molecule will move further across the gel than a larger DNA molecule will. The gel electrophoresis of the DNA after digestion with a non-specific nuclease revealed a ladder-like pattern, indicating that the DNA was fragmented into multiple sizes. This pattern was consistent with the formation of nucleosomes, which are comprised of DNA wrapped around histone proteins, and suggested that the chromosomal DNA had been organized into repeating units of nucleosomes.
